Vine to moderate second ABTA convention
BBC Radio 2 presenter Jeremy Vine has been signed up to moderate his second Travel Convention organised by ABTA.
Vine, who also fronts BBC TV’s Panorama, was selected again for his “unique mix of entertaining banter, sharp wit and incisive interviewing techniqueâ€.
The Travel Convention will be held on October 6-8 in Gran Canaria.
ABTA chief executive Mark Tanzer said: “We are privileged that Jeremy will guide us through the business sessions again. He did a fantastic job last time. He’s a real pro, keeps everyone on their toes and ensures lively debate throughout.â€
The Travel Convention starts on October 6 with hosted fam trips for agents and a full sports programme.
Business sessions will run the following two days with master classes, plenary slots and talk zones.
A Fun Run in aid of the Family Holidays Association followed by a Mega Fiesta will be held on October 7.
Private events and a Starlight Party will be held on October 8 and further excursions and fam trips will be possible the following day, according to ABTA.
